Hi, I am a Wings of Liberty player. Here is my question. Is it possible to do the 11 minute 1-1 timing in TvZ to clear creep without speed medivacs? How else can you limit creep spread in early mid game, beside the initial 6 hellions?
EsportsJohn
Profile Blog Joined June 2012
United States4883 Posts
October 12 2014 15:13 GMT
#16787
On October 12 2014 09:07 fapuccino wrote:
Hi, I am a Wings of Liberty player. Here is my question. Is it possible to do the 11 minute 1-1 timing in TvZ to clear creep without speed medivacs? How else can you limit creep spread in early mid game, beside the initial 6 hellions?


This is a pretty natural timing to make medivacs, so I'm not sure why you would intentionally try to skip the medivacs. If you don't have medivacs, this pressure becomes more like a dedicated attack (I'm thinking some kind of stimmed bio + hellbat type of push), and you really shouldn't be wasting time clearing creep with it anyway.

A possibility for limiting creep is the "qxc bunker", which is a relatively early bunker near the natural ramp of your opponent to stop the creep tumors from pushing down the ramp too early; however, this is less useful against gas openings and more powerful against the 4-queen or 6-queen openers.

Otherwise, you really should have too much of a problem stopping creep with reaper/hellion if you're really staying on top of it. Just mark the exact times that the creep tumors get thrown down and practice coming in with your hellions solely just to snipe the active creep tumors.

How much time after warping in a high templar will it be able to cast storm?
Meavis
Profile Blog Joined September 2011
Netherlands1300 Posts
October 22 2014 14:29 GMT
#16795
On October 22 2014 22:26 AkashSky wrote:
How much time after warping in a high templar will it be able to cast storm?

44seconds to generate 25 energy from 50 from warp-in to the required 75

On October 09 2014 20:44 Quateras wrote:
Quick quesiton : does anyone actually know at what point or under what reason Blizzard fixed the Carpet Bombing with Baneling drops into army?

I remmeber hearing sometime in 2011 or 2012 that they changed the way that BLings dont drop on top anymore but on the sides or something?

Wouldn't bringing it back make ZvP more fun again too?Or was it OP?
(PS : recently watched some 2010 and 2011 games and it seems like a such a cool thing :D)

Erm, Before the change to that it was possible to drop banelings anywhere underneath an overlord.
After the change, banelings would first 'land' on a suitable location, before exploding.

In practice, this made carpet bombs not devastate clumps of units from the inside, but rather made them explode on the outside of the units, making the damage not as massive.

IIRC (may very well be wrong on this) it was changed because banelings bombing + zerglings/roaches completely raped anything not collosus/archon/air Protoss could put on the field.
